K-pop sensation ZEROBASEONE has once again demonstrated its global prowess by setting a new personal best on the Billboard 200, the main album chart in the United States.

According to the latest charts released by Billboard on September 16th (local time), ZEROBASEONE's first full-length album, 'NEVER SAY NEVER,' debuted at an impressive 23rd position.

This significant achievement surpasses their previous record of 28th place with their fifth mini-album, 'BLUE PARADISE.' With this new peak, ZEROBASEONE has firmly established itself as a 'Global Top Tier' artist, achieving the highest ranking among fifth-generation K-pop groups on the Billboard 200.

Beyond the main album chart, ZEROBASEONE also saw remarkable success across various Billboard sub-charts. They secured the No. 1 spot on 'Emerging Artists,' second on 'World Albums,' third on 'Independent Albums,' fifth on 'Top Album Sales' and 'Top Current Album Sales,' and nineteenth on 'Artist 100,' marking their presence on a total of seven charts.

The album 'NEVER SAY NEVER' has also achieved phenomenal commercial success, selling over 1.51 million copies in its first week of release, making ZEROBASEONE a '6-time Million Seller.' The album has also garnered significant attention by topping charts in Japan's Oricon and China's QQ Music, further proving their international appeal.

Furthermore, their title track 'ICONIK' achieved a grand slam by securing first place on domestic music shows for six consecutive days, a first in the group's history. This consistent success underlines ZEROBASEONE's iconic journey of growth.

Looking ahead, ZEROBASEONE is set to kick off their world tour 'HERE&NOW' in October at the KSPO DOME in Seoul, with tickets already selling out rapidly, indicating their immense popularity.

ZEROBASEONE, a nine-member group formed through the Mnet survival show 'Boys Planet,' debuted on July 10, 2023. The group's name signifies the members starting from zero and coming together as one. Their music often conveys messages of hope and growth.
